![]() Benjamin soon dies of tuberculosis, and his parents take his body away on a canoe to be blessed by a priest, leaving Saul with his grandmother. When Benjamin suddenly returns after escaping a residential school, the family moves to Gods Lake, a remote region where their ancestors lived. ![]() ![]() In 1961, the Indian Horse family-an Ojibway family consisting of eight-year-old Saul, his grandmother Naomi, and his Christian parents John and Mary-live in the wilderness of Northern Ontario, hiding from the authorities, who previously took Saul's siblings, Benjamin and Rachel, to residential schools.
